102402Dat160601Mergers (JOI19_mergers)C++17
100 / 100
2987 ms204916 KiB
#include <bits/stdc++.h>
using namespace std;
#define mp make_pair
#define pb push_back
#define fi first
#define se second

const int N = 5e5 + 7;

int n, k, u, v, s[N], level[N], sub[N], par[20][N], cnt = 0, pset[N], ret[N], sz[N], deg[N], now[N], ans = 0;
bool vis[N], col[N];
vector <int> edge[N], tp[N], g[N], leaf;
unordered_map < long long, int > ed;

int read(){
	char p;
	while((p = getchar())){
		if(p < '0' || p > '9') continue;
		break;
	}
	int ret = p - '0';
	while((p = getchar())){
		if(p >= '0' && p <= '9'){
			ret *= 10;
			ret += p - '0';
		}
		else break;
	}
	return ret;
}

void predfs(int u, int p){
	int ch = 0;
	for(int v : edge[u]){
		if(v == p) continue;
		deg[u]++;
		par[0][v] = u;
		level[v] = level[u] + 1;
		predfs(v, u);
		ch++;
	}
	if(ch == 0) leaf.pb(u);
}

int lca(int u, int v){
	if(level[u] > level[v]) swap(u, v);
	for(int i = 19; i >= 0; i--) if(level[par[i][v]] >= level[u]) v = par[i][v];
	for(int i = 19; i >= 0; i--) if(par[i][u] != par[i][v]) u = par[i][u], v = par[i][v];
	if(u == v) return u;
	return par[0][u];
}

int fset(int x){
	if(pset[x] == x) return x;
	return pset[x] = fset(pset[x]);
}

void unionset(int u, int v){
	u = fset(u), v = fset(v);
	if(u == v) return;
	if(now[u] <= now[v]){
		pset[u] = v;
		sz[v] += sz[u];
		sz[u] = 0;
		now[v] += now[u];
		now[u] = 0;
	}
	else{
		pset[v] = u;
		sz[u] += sz[v];
		sz[v] = 0;
		now[u] += now[v];
		now[v] = 0;
	}
}

void dfs(int u, int p){
	int child = 0;
	for(int v : g[u]){
		if(v == p) continue;
		child ++;
		dfs(v, u);
	}
	if(child == 0 || (child == 1 && u == 1)) ans++;
}

int main(){
	n = read(), k = read();
	for(int i = 1; i < n; i++){
		u = read(), v = read();
		edge[u].pb(v);
		edge[v].pb(u);
	}
	for(int i = 1; i <= n; i++){
		s[i] = read();
		tp[s[i]].pb(i);
	}
	par[0][1] = 1;
	level[1] = 1;
	predfs(1, 1);
	for(int i = 1; i <= 19; i++){
		for(int j = 1; j <= n; j++){
			par[i][j] = par[i - 1][par[i - 1][j]];
		}
	}
	for(int i = 1; i <= k; i++){
		now[i] = 1;
		pset[i] = i;
		sz[i] = 1;
		if(tp[i].empty()) continue;
		int cur = tp[i][0];
		for(int j = 1; j < (int)tp[i].size(); j++){
			cur = lca(cur, tp[i][j]);
		}
		sub[cur]++;
	}
	queue <int> q;
	for(int x : leaf) q.push(x);
	while(!q.empty()){
		int u = q.front();
		q.pop();
		int p = fset(s[u]);
		sz[p] -= sub[u];
		deg[par[0][u]]--;
		if(!deg[par[0][u]]){
			q.push(par[0][u]);
		}
		if(sz[p] == 0) continue;
		unionset(p, s[par[0][u]]);
	}
	for(int i = 1; i <= k; i++){
		if(pset[i] == i) ret[i] = ++cnt;
	}
	for(int i = 1; i <= k; i++){
		if(pset[i] != i) ret[i] = ret[fset(i)];
	}
	for(int i = 1; i <= n; i++){
		int id = ret[s[i]];
		for(int j : edge[i]){
			int jd = ret[s[j]];
			if(id == jd) continue;
			if(ed[1LL * id * N + jd] > 0) continue;
			g[id].pb(jd);
			g[jd].pb(id);
			ed[1LL * id * N + jd]++;
			ed[1LL * jd * N + id]++;
		}
	}
	dfs(1, 1);
	if(ans == 1) printf("0");
	else printf("%d", (ans + 1) / 2);
}
